Automated Delivery
Till date, we have seen delivery executives reaching out to your doorstep to deliver your food. How about replacing this with the automated systems?
 
Yes, you heard it right. Sooner would we see bots knocking your door to deliver food?
 
- Drones
One of the biggest food giants, Zomato has tested custom based drone delivery and saw that using drones and not human delivery executives would help the company cut down the delivery time by 50%. This would not only enhance the entire delivery process but also cope with traffic hues and unnecessary wait times.
 
- Robot
Collaborating with Yelp and Marble, eat24 another food delivery chain devised a customized not, one of the sizes of an office table. This robot has been tailored to aid the task of food delivery. Utilizing sensors, advanced cameras, and 3D city map, these on wheel robots find the best route to reach you in the least possible time. This in a way helps avoid humans, bumps, traffic, pets, cycle, etc.
 
- Parachute
The float down eatery was witnessed for the first time in Massachusetts from Jafflechutes. Tasty and delicious sandwiches flying high in the air with customers waiting at the pickup point to hold on to their food packets in the air.

Multi Delivery Channels
Delivery channels have been one of the drawbacks when it comes to online food delivery. Bad or poor customer experience compel customers to abandon digital channels for ordering food. To deal with this, the Y generation entrepreneurs are looking for alternative delivery channels that not only add more options but further ease the entire delivery process.
 
a) Order Via Tweets: Technology has made things easier and better and trusts me, the first time I came across this I was totally stunned. Order by tweeting the emoji of pizza, Dominos has stepped in the era of transformation. Okay, here's a question, how would dominos know which pizza are you actually ordering? Let's get to this. Prior to ordering or rather putting up an emoji, you need to have pizza profile made on the online delivery service of dominos. Tracking this, dominos can take your default order as the current order.
 
b) Order Via Virtual Assistants: Dominos is here again at the forefront. Embedding virtual bots in Facebook messenger, Dominos Dom is all set to help customers place an order by interacting with the assistant. And not just this, the assistant would happily assist you on available deals and active vouchers.
 
c) Order Via SmartWatch: Now tweets and virtual assistants were user optimized method, but the next in line is ordering via smartwatches. Meaning that you need not tap on your phone, instead use your smartwatch and place an order in a few clicks. Dominoz and Order up are the ones using this method.
 
And this is not done yet. Added to the above are ordering via eyes, via car, and via TV. No doubt, the future of online food delivery is rising beyond expectations.
